De Cerbi praises Guardiola: “I became a coach because of him, I loved the Barcelona he built.”
Roberto de Cerbi led Brighton to the Europa League and idolized Pep Guardiola after the 1-1 draw with Manchester City, stressing he was the reason he chose coaching.
Brighton clinched the long-awaited point against Manchester City on Wednesday (May 24) and secured their ticket for the new season’s Europa League with a 1-1 draw.
Roberto de Cerbi was mentioned in his post-match statements pep Guardiola, whom he adored. The Italy manager revealed that Guardiola inspired and motivated him to choose coaching.
“I became a coach because of Guardiola because I loved his Barcelona.” I studied him a lot, I didn’t copy him, but I learned things when I started coaching. Pep is still number one.
He then praised his players for their dedication and performances this season: “It was very difficult but we knew it was always difficult to play against City. We played very well, we deserved to get a point, we deserved to play Europe League”.
